Layout Quebrado no IReport[RESOLVIDO]  XML
Índice dos Fóruns » Java Avançado
Autor Mensagem
Ironlynx
Moderador
[Avatar]

Membro desde: 02/05/2003 01:06:41
Mensagens: 3515
Localização: The other side of the screen
Offline

Opa pessoal!Eu ia postar um exemplo aqui de relatório usando beans(um Principal e um subrelatório Auxiliar), mas a coisa não ficou 100%: O subrelatório está sempre saindo em outra página, mesmo tendo espaço, e eu ter referenciado ele no relatório principal.
Vejam:


ou aqui:
http://img222.imageshack.us/img222/1088/erroplanilhawl6.jpg

Não sei o que tá rolando, mesmo desmarcando "divisão permitida" e tentando alguns truques aqui, o relatório sai em 2 folhas.(pûs os 2 jrxml-Principal e Auxiliar no anexo)
 Nome do arquivo IReport.zip [Disk] Download
 Descrição
 Tamanho 4 Kbytes
 Baixado:  51 vez(es)

This message was edited 1 time. Last update was at 14/01/2009 16:25:52


Não basta persistir...tem que prevalecer!
Ironlynx
Anarquista de Sistemas
http://osereojava.blogspot.com/
[WWW]
Ironlynx
Moderador
[Avatar]

Membro desde: 02/05/2003 01:06:41
Mensagens: 3515
Localização: The other side of the screen
Offline

Diminui ainda mais os espaços, mas nada!!!
Alguém teria uma vaga idéia?(Eu quero por o código aqui como exemplo de relatório-subrelatório com Beans para o pessoal, mas não quero pôr um relatório que apesar de exibir os dados corretamente, está com layout "quebrado"...)
Anexei o pdf gerado.
 Nome do arquivo Principal.pdf [Disk] Download
 Descrição
 Tamanho 11 Kbytes
 Baixado:  58 vez(es)


Não basta persistir...tem que prevalecer!
Ironlynx
Anarquista de Sistemas
http://osereojava.blogspot.com/
[WWW]
Ironlynx
Moderador
[Avatar]

Membro desde: 02/05/2003 01:06:41
Mensagens: 3515
Localização: The other side of the screen
Offline

Consegui por todos os dados(relatório principal+ o do subreport) só numa folha, zerando todas as bandas (menos a Detail lógico) do meu relatório Principal.
Melhorou pacas, mas ainda tem um grande problema: cria sempre uma inútil página a mais, com um pedaço do logo(ver anexo).
Alguém já teve problema similar???
 Nome do arquivo Principal.pdf [Disk] Download
 Descrição
 Tamanho 11 Kbytes
 Baixado:  65 vez(es)


Não basta persistir...tem que prevalecer!
Ironlynx
Anarquista de Sistemas
http://osereojava.blogspot.com/
[WWW]
Ironlynx
Moderador
[Avatar]

Membro desde: 02/05/2003 01:06:41
Mensagens: 3515
Localização: The other side of the screen
Offline

Bom, depois de muito mexer(é um saco ter que ficar "tateando" algo até acertar, a documentação podia melhorar...), o tio Iron matou, e o pior que foi de uma forma simples(arrrrgghhh!!!):Matei todas as bandas de todos os relatórios, só deixando a Detail em cada um(tanto no Principal como no Auxiliar).Para ficar registrado de como fazer, usei 2 Beans:


Uma classe TestaDados, que é a minha Fonte de dados no IReport, pelo método getBeanCollection:

E uma Classe que executa o relatório:

Os .jrxml estão zipados no anexo.Lembrando que eu usei como logo uma figura de 790x90.
 Nome do arquivo RelatorioUsandoBeans.zip [Disk] Download
 Descrição
 Tamanho 4 Kbytes
 Baixado:  49 vez(es)


Não basta persistir...tem que prevalecer!
Ironlynx
Anarquista de Sistemas
http://osereojava.blogspot.com/
[WWW]
 
Índice dos Fóruns » Java Avançado
Ir para:   
Powered by JForum 2.1.8 © JForum Team